If you have misalignment issues, you don’t need to opt for a mouthful of metal brackets and wires to get the results you are hoping for. Instead, you can opt for clear aligners. This treatment works by slowly shifting your teeth to their new, rightful locations. Read on to learn more about the process of clear aligners so you know exactly what to expect.
Consultation
The first step of the clear aligners process is your initial consultation. At this time, it is determined whether or not you are an ideal candidate for the treatment. Clear aligners can be used to address a wide range of misalignment issues, but there are still some that are too complex, so they require the help of traditional braces. During this consultation, you will be able to confirm that this is the right treatment option for you.
Preparation
To prepare for your treatment, X-rays are taken of your teeth, and a model of your smile is created. This is used so your orthodontist can craft a customized treatment plan to meet your needs.
Receiving Your Aligners
After a few weeks, your aligners will be ready! Some small adjustments may be made, like adding buttons to your teeth. These small, tooth-colored bumps are made from cosmetic resin and placed on the front-facing surfaces of the teeth. Their purpose is to keep the aligners in place, allowing for the perfect amount of pressure to be put on specific teeth.
Follow-Up Appointments
You need to return to the dental office regularly to ensure that your teeth move as planned. Even with a detailed plan, your teeth can still move unexpectedly. It is important to catch issues like that immediately so adjustments can be made to keep your smile on track with your treatment plan.
Refinements
Once your series of aligners is complete, your dentist will examine your smile to see if you need any refinement. If you do, you will receive some additional trays to make some finishing adjustments. This way, you and your orthodontist can ensure that you are satisfied with your final results.
Retainers
Lastly, all of the buttons are removed, and your clear aligners will be switched out for a retainer. This looks just like your alignment trays that you are used to, but the purpose is to prevent your teeth from shifting back to their original locations.
